The Peralta Hills Ranch is one of the few large tracts of viewshed properties not encumbered with a conservation easement remaining in the Big Horn area. The contiguous ranch is situated on the eastern slope of the Beaver Creek Hills just minutes from downtown Sheridan, Wyoming.
This blank canvas property features numerous ponds and coulees that provide excellent habitat for mule deer, whitetail, elk, and upland birds. The Peralta irrigation ditch provides another excellent water feature as it traverses across four large draws lined with wild plumb trees and grassland prairie hills. Expansive views of the Big Horn Mountains from Story towards the Montana state line . The entire Little Goose valley greets you each morning.
